Accounting is a trust-and-deadline business with a brutal seasonal spike. Clients hand over their most sensitive financial information, so credibility and security matter enormously, and the work is punctuated by tax deadlines that turn the office into a document-chasing pressure cooker every spring. The two defining digital challenges for a CPA firm are secure client-document collection and surviving the seasonal crush without drowning in email attachments and phone tag.

Yet most accounting-firm websites are static brochures, and document collection happens over insecure email while the front desk chases missing W-2s and receipts one client at a time. Clients increasingly expect a secure portal to upload documents, e-sign engagement letters, and check on their return — and to book a consultation without a phone call. The digital reality for an accounting firm is that a secure client portal and automated document collection are the highest-value builds, because they attack exactly the security risk and the seasonal chaos that define the work.

Where accounting firms lose time and money online

Sensitive documents collected over insecure email

Clients email tax documents full of Social Security numbers and financial data because there's no secure alternative, exposing both client and firm to real risk. A secure upload portal isn't a nicety here — it's a professional and liability necessity that email fundamentally can't meet.

Seasonal document chasing consumes the firm

Every tax season, staff spend enormous time chasing clients for missing documents, tracking who's submitted what, and answering 'did you get my forms?' emails. This manual scramble is the single biggest time sink in the calendar, and it recurs like clockwork.

Engagement letters and onboarding by hand

New clients mean engagement letters to send and sign, organizers to distribute, and information to collect — usually by email and manual follow-up. Slow, manual onboarding delays the actual work and frustrates clients at the worst possible time of year.

Consultation scheduling as phone tag

Prospective and existing clients booking a consult play phone tag around the accountant's calendar, especially when everyone wants time in the same few weeks. Manual scheduling caps how many conversations the firm can have during its busiest stretch.
